Peter O Reilly has one (Filmed on Lough Conn) and there is a fella from Lough Derg Area with one out. Cant remember the names of either. Roy Pierce has a faily recent one filmed on the Corrib. You can only buy from him direct. Google Grasshopper Cottage.

Tell you buddy to look at Cong this year, Corrib has been a big pile of Sh!te for the last 4 years, with hatches very thin on the Ground and very few fish rising. As a result I have not booked my Mayfly week on Corrib for the first time in 9 years.
